  6. #6
    If he's slow playing a set, which it kinda looks like on the turn raise, you have 8/46 (8 because if the 2c comes and he has a set, he just made a boat or 4 of a kind) outs to make a flush and 6$ to call into a 15$ pot. Thats assuming that your flush outs are clean, here they arent but you had no way of knowing that.

    So you could make an argument to just fold to his turn raise.

  9. #9
    Quote Originally Posted by Shadowskills
    My bet was the size of the pot.
    True but if you're betting the pot when a 3c comes on the turn, your opponent has to be thinking it ain't the 3 that helped you there but perhaps the flush draw or straight draw (flush draw is more likely since you would have had to limp wth A4, A5, 45 or 46 to be put on a straight draw). So your pot sized bet really looked to me like a drawing bet and if he figured that out it was a really good move from your opponent to go all-in on the river since he had the nut flush and he perhaps knew you had it too.

    Well, maybe I'm pushing this a little too far but it makes sense to me

    Anyway FOLD PREFLOP
